commit 09cf314b55b9cf70595caa1450e1ac176e529fa2
Author: Joanmarie Diggs <jdiggs igalia com>
Date: Mon Jul 8 12:29:54 2019 -0400
Be sure mouse review object is in current document before presenting it
src/orca/mouse_review.py | 5 +++++
1 file changed, 5 insertions(+)
---
diff --git a/src/orca/mouse_review.py b/src/orca/mouse_review.py
index ef246562a..ade98d3d8 100644
--- a/src/orca/mouse_review.py
+++ b/src/orca/mouse_review.py
@@ -422,6 +422,11 @@ class MouseReviewer:
debug.println(debug.LEVEL_INFO, msg, True)
return
+ if document and obj and document != script.utilities.getContainingDocument(obj):
+ msg = "MOUSE REVIEW: %s is not in active document %s" % (obj, document)
+ debug.println(debug.LEVEL_INFO, msg, True)
+ return
+
if obj and obj.getRole() in script.utilities.getCellRoles() \
and script.utilities.shouldReadFullRow(obj):
isRow = lambda x: x and x.getRole() == pyatspi.ROLE_TABLE_ROW
